Subject: Re: [PATCH v9 27/30] KVM: arm64: selftests: Remove spurious check for single bit safe values
Date: Tue, 13 Jan 2026 10:05:15 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<dcbeb11f-bebe-465a-be4e-2461d3efc21b@arm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20251223-kvm-arm64-sme-v9-27-8be3867cb883@kernel.org>

Hi Mark,

On 12/23/25 01:21, Mark Brown wrote:
> get_safe_value() currently asserts that bitfields it is generating a safe
> value for must be more than one bit wide but in actual fact it should
> always be possible to generate a safe value to write to a bitfield even if
> it is just the current value and the function correctly handles that.
> Remove the assert.
> 
> Fixes: bf09ee918053e ("KVM: arm64: selftests: Remove ARM64_FEATURE_FIELD_BITS and its last user")
> Signed-off-by: Mark Brown <broonie@kernel.org>

Yes, this assert was unneeded.

Reviewed-by: Ben Horgan <ben.horgan@arm.com>
